Output 65b40285fb9a8d16e15d8ac1fb255e1de189c7c8d9fd4e19267ed859d78c9d0a:7

value
235000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2a5bedc1f27c04f9390224f39903254dee1040e OP_EQUAL
address
3Pp21AmKdLihTzYeuYtrgAYtisLjV24dAv
transaction
65b40285fb9a8d16e15d8ac1fb255e1de189c7c8d9fd4e19267ed859d78c9d0a
confirmations
243979
spent
true